Geocentric is not a place, rather it is the name for the model of the solar system which places the earth at the centre and all other bodies revolve around it. This was considered the correct model for centuries.

The heliocentric model places the sun at the centre of the solar system and all other bodies rotate around the sun. We now know this is the correct configuration.

Which observer cannot be explained by a geocentric model?

The observer who cannot be explained by a geocentric model is one who sees the phases of Venus. In a geocentric model, Venus would always be positioned between the Earth and the Sun, preventing it from showing a full range of phases like those observed. The heliocentric model, which places the Sun at the center, accurately accounts for these phases as Venus orbits the Sun and can be positioned at varying angles relative to the Earth and Sun. This discrepancy was one of the key pieces of evidence that led to the acceptance of the heliocentric model.

Did Aristotle support the heilocentric and geocentric model?

Aristotle supported the geocentric model, which placed Earth at the center of the universe. He did not propose a heliocentric model with the Sun at the center. It was later astronomers like Copernicus who challenged the geocentric model in favor of a heliocentric one.
